To find hydraulic horsepower, use the equation: HP = (PSI X GPM) / 1714. PSI = Pressure in Pounds per Square Inch. GPM = Flow Rate in Gallons per Minute. Example: Calculate hydraulic horsepower when pressure is 2000psi and flow rate is 20GPM: Horsepower = (2000 x 20) / 1714. Calculated out this gives a hydraulic horsepower of 23.34.

Horsepower = (3,000 x 6) / 63,025 = 0.286. 63,025 is a constant when using RPM for speed and in-lbf for torque units. 5,252 is another common constant if the speed is in RPM and torque is in ft-lbf. If the units are different then simply make the unit conversion. The derivation of these constants is done using the 33,000 ft-lbf /min = 1 horsepower.

Let's say we have a vehicle that weighs 1500 pounds and has a horsepower (hp) of 200. Its PWR will be as 0.133 hp/lb, which entails that it has a power output of 0.133 hp for every pound of weight. Calculating PWR. It's very easy to calculate a power-to-weight ratio. Simply divide the power output of a vehicle by its weight.

However, the exact hp value can vary depending on multiple factors, such as the engine type, stroke, aspiration, and compression ratio.One horsepower is equivalent to the amount of force needed to lift 550 lbs of weight within a period of 1 second. One horsepower is equal to 745.7 watts, watts being a unit of power that James Watt also came up with, and the same unit you see everyday associated with things like light bulbs and electrical devices.
